MAAS Announces Strategic Expansion into Healthcare and Wellness with Acquisition of Carve Group Ltd - Maase (NASDAQ:MAAS)

CHENGDU, China, Aug. 28, 2025 ( GLOBE NEWSWIRE ) -- Maase Inc. MAAS ( "MAAS" or the "Company" ) today announced the successful completion of its strategic acquisition of 100% equity interests in Carve Group Ltd ( the "Target Company" or the "Carve Group" ) .

Rocket Lab Just Unveiled a Game-Changing Technology Worth Watching

Rocket Lab (RKLB) said it won a $397 million U.S. Space Force contract to develop, launch, and operate multiple Flatellites for the SB-AMTI program. Flatellites are slimmer, stackable satellites intended to increase deployments per launch and integrate with Rocket Lab’s Neutron rocket. The article cites analyst forecasts for revenue rising from $602M (2025) to $1.7B (2028).

Bloomberg: US to purchase anti-drone lasers for $400 million

Bloomberg reports the Pentagon will buy laser-based counter-drone systems from AeroVironment Inc. in a deal valued at at least $400 million. The contract is expected to supply the Army with dozens of Locust systems, described as an AI-enabled laser system for tracking and disabling small and medium UAVs. AeroVironment shares rose 8.1% intraday, according to the report.

Pentagon to invest $400m in Australian rare earth mine

Sunrise Energy Metals said the US Pentagon will provide a conditional $400 million loan commitment to develop Syerston, a proposed scandium mine in Fifield, NSW. The project targets Western supply of scandium used in defence and other sectors amid China’s export restrictions. Sunrise also said it has a deal with Lockheed Martin for 25% of output for five years.
